The Levana children are learning that when we return to school each Monday, we all gather to celebrate Havdalah. We say good-bye to Shabbat, and hello to the new week. The children participate using multiple senses: they smell the spices (Joshua is handing out cinnamon sticks), they sing and dance, watch the flame of the candle and feel its warmth, and hear the blessings. They become thoroughly engaged in this ritual which connects us to Shabbat and to one another.
